Issiaga Camara (born 2 February 2005) is a Guinean professional footballer who plays as a midfielder for French Championnat National club Dijon on loan from Nice.

Early life

Camara was born in Conakry, Guinea, and moved to France at the age of 11. He began his football journey with amateur clubs, including Beaune FC, before joining the youth academy of OGC Nice in 2016. [1]

Club career

Camara progressed through the ranks at OGC Nice, signing his first professional contract with the club in 2024. He made his Ligue 1 debut in the 2024–25 season, appearing against AJ Auxerre. [2] He has also been included in OGC Nice's squads for Europa League and French Cup matches, reflecting his growing importance to the team. [3]

On 31 January 2025, Camara was loaned to Dijon in Championnat National. [4]

International career

Eligible to represent Guinea, Camara has been capped by the Guinea U23 national team. He also represented them during the 2024 Summer Olympics, appearing for them in 2 of the 3 group stage matches. [5]
